### Highlights
Develop your mountain biking skills and build on your existing knowledge with this specialised coaching session designed to boost your confidence on more technical trails. The focus is on improving core techniques, including hopping, lifting, and cornering, so you can ride with greater speed and control. Led by Steve, a highly experienced British Cycling-certified MTB coach, this course ensures you’ll get the most from your time on the trails. Key Details Duration: 3 hours Location: Coed y Brenin Suitable For: Intermediate riders Group Size: Small group for personal attention Key Skills Mastering wheel lifts (powered and manual) Learning bunny hops and trail hops Perfecting step-ups and drop-offs Enhancing cornering technique (berms, flat and off-camber turns) Energy management for smoother rides What to Expect Over the three-hour session, you'll cover essential techniques to refine your trail riding. The session kicks off with a recap of basic skills before delving into more advanced manoeuvres. You’ll learn how to lift your front wheel with both powered and manual methods, ideal for clearing obstacles or navigating tricky terrain. From there, Steve will guide you through bunny hops and trail hops, ensuring you can smoothly lift both wheels over obstacles. Next, you’ll tackle step-ups and drop-offs, gaining the confidence to handle more technical sections of a trail. As the session progresses, you’ll sharpen your cornering technique, working on berms, flat turns, and off-camber turns. Steve will also cover energy management, teaching you how to maintain flow on a trail and conserve energy for longer rides. By the end of the session, you’ll leave with improved technique, a deeper understanding of energy use, and the ability to ride faster and with more control. Location The session takes place at Coed y Brenin, offering a fantastic location for intermediate mountain bikers looking to test their skills on technical terrain. The surrounding trails provide the perfect blend of challenge and variety. Prerequisites This course is designed for riders who have completed a beginner MTB course or have equivalent experience. You should be comfortable on blue-graded trails and have a good grasp of fundamental MTB techniques. ## FAQs

### What level of fitness is required for this course?

A moderate level of fitness is recommended for the course, as it involves three hours of technical riding. You should be comfortable riding for extended periods, tackling inclines, and navigating challenging terrain.

### Do I need to have prior experience?

Yes, this course is aimed at intermediate riders. You should already be confident on blue-graded trails and have basic MTB skills such as gear shifting, braking, and balancing. If you've completed a beginner course, you'll be well-prepared for this session. You can find our Core Skills session at the bottom of this page if you need a refresher!

### Can I hire a bike for the course?

We do not provide bikes, so you'll need to bring your own. However, if you don't own a suitable mountain bike, you can arrange to hire one in advance. Please contact us using the details on your booking confirmation to hire a bike for your course.

### What equipment should I bring?

You’ll need a mountain bike in good working condition, a helmet (mandatory), and protective gear such as gloves and knee pads. We also recommend bringing water, snacks, and appropriate clothing for variable weather conditions.

### Is this course suitable for younger riders?

While we don't have a specific age limit, participants should have intermediate MTB skills and be comfortable handling technical terrain. If younger riders meet these criteria, they are welcome to join.
